Author: marino Date: Thu Nov 3 18:00:50 2016 New Revision: 425265 URL: https://svnweb.freebsd.org/changeset/ports/425265 Log: ports-mgmt/synth: Upgrade version 1.63 => 1.64 Change in hook behavior: Now the initial building of pkg(8) triggers a success or failure hook after building. Before ports-mgmt/pkg was the only port that could never trigger these hooks. The "bulk run start" hook is triggered afterwords as pkg(8) is a prerequisite to preparing the bulk run. Fix potential bad unmount of /usr/src In the case where /usr/src exists, but the profiles uses a system root that is not "/" and doesn't have an "usr/src" subdirectory, an error would be emitted as the unmount of the non-existant mount failed. This uncommon use case has been fixed. Curses display builder "Elapsed" label changed to "Duration" This matches the format of the web-based report DragonFly only: Support File(1) v2.0 version parsing The output of file(1) version on DragonFly will change with version 2.0. For example, what is now version 4.0.702 will be displayed as 4.7.2 on newer versions of file(1). Moreover, the parsing for DragonFly 4.10+ would not have worked. Now both versions are supports and the double- digit minor versions are properly handled as well.
